Description
Occupying a particularly generous plot overlooking Jimmy's Lake, this extended three-bedroom semi-detached home offers approximately 1,290sqft of accommodation, together with a detached double garage, separate garden room and an exciting opportunity for further development.
What makes No.20 particularly unusual is the combination of an established family home and the potential offered by its substantial side plot. Planning permission has previously been granted for the demolition of the existing garage and construction of a separate three-bedroom detached dwelling, creating an opportunity likely to appeal to families, developers and self-builders alike.
The House:
The existing home is considerably larger than its traditional semi-detached appearance might initially suggest.
The ground floor includes a generous living and dining area leading through to an impressive rear living room measuring approximately 7.11m x 3.67m. Two sets of French doors open directly onto the garden, creating a bright and spacious room ideal for family life and entertaining.
There is also a separate fitted kitchen offering a good range of storage and preparation space, together with a ground-floor WC.
Upstairs are three bedrooms and the family bathroom. The principal bedroom is a particularly generous room measuring approximately 4.36m x 3.39m, while the second bedroom is another good-sized double and incorporates a separate dressing room. The third bedroom would work equally well as a child's bedroom, nursery or home office.
The substantial roof space may also offer potential for additional accommodation, subject to the necessary consents and technical requirements.
Outside:
The plot is one of the defining features of No.20. The generous rear garden provides excellent space for families and outdoor entertaining, with the outlook towards Jimmy's Lake contributing to the property's surprisingly leafy setting.
To the side stands a substantial detached double garage measuring approximately 6.93m x 5.66m, with an adjoining utility room.
There is also a separate garden room of approximately 28.5 sq m with its own bathroom facilities, providing valuable additional space for entertaining, hobbies, working from home or other ancillary uses.
The Development Opportunity:
Planning permission has previously been granted for the demolition of the detached garage and construction of a separate three-bedroom detached dwelling with rooms within the roof, private garden and parking.
For a developer or self-builder, this presents the unusual opportunity to acquire an existing family home together with potential for an additional dwelling. Alternatively, a purchaser could simply enjoy the property, garage and extensive gardens as they are, retaining the development potential for the future.
Interested parties should make their own enquiries regarding the current status of the planning permission and satisfy themselves as to all planning, building regulation and development matters.
